What are the five major ways that can change language?

Language can change thru inventions, new ideas, historical events, individual discovery and historical events. Acculturation happens in historical events like colonization. Technology has changed language in the sense that people are using new words invented by technology.  There are some words being learned when a person creates a new one when they discover something

<h3>What is the Ming Dynasty?</h3>

This refers to the period in Chinese history that shows the last dynasty rule in China that lasted from 1368 to 1644.
